The Army Cadet Force is a youth organisation sponsored by the UK's Ministry of Defence. It instils all the best core values of Her Majesty's Forces into young people - so as to enable them to live better and more fulfilling lives. This is achieved by means of fantastic training packages that include adventure training, military skills such as shooting and field craft, first aid and even foreign travel.In an era when the youth of today are so often seen as out of control and lacking direction, Mike Ryan presents a study of an organisation that seeks to provide key skills to its members, 30% of whom go on to join the armed forces. This book honours these young people who are a credit to our country, and yet seldom get recognition for their achievements.
